With the current proposal, we aim to investigate variations in the magnetic exchange coupling and the hybridization during the phase transition in the all-d Heusler magnetocaloric compound NiCoMnTi with varying Co and Ti concentrations. We could show that slight adjustments of the compositions control the occurring magnetostructural phase transition in a combined experimental and theoretical study. With the current proposal, we intend to simultaneously perform XMCD and XRD measurements at the 3d-TM K edges – revealing changes off the magnetic moments and the lattice structures during the austenite-martensite phase transition within the newly established ULMAG setup. These results will be supported by ab-initio DFT calculations and will help tailor the magnetocaloric properties in this class of materials.
